
The city has moved forward with plans to demolish Texas Stadium via implosion, which was determined to be the safest way to remove the structure.
Dallas-based Weir Brothers was awarded approximately $5.9 million to implode the iconic stadium. The company will help ensure that the city’s environmental stewardship goals are satisfied. Included in these initiatives is a directive for 95 percent of the concrete and steel to be recycled.
The Texas Department of Transportation is leasing the stadium property for a staging area during reconstruction of the adjacent highways. Notice to proceed with the demolition is expected this month. Preliminary scheduling places the implosion in early 2010, with a completion date of next July.
